    Shelby A.

    A great local eatery with fantastic food and drinks. The service is always friendly but can be a little slow on the busier nights. The flat bread pizza is a must try here. My favorite is the Bee Sting pie. Very cozy interior, the only downside is on the inside there is a cigar lounge so you can still smell smoke depending where you are seated inside. Desserts here are also a must, the strawberry ny style cheesecake is absolutely to die for. The kickin' watermelon is a nice twist on a spicy margarita with fresh and spicy jalapeños, tajin, and the perfect compliment of sweet watermelon. I highly recommend their New England style clam chowder. It's perfectly flavorful, not too heavy, and great no matter what season.

    Finally! A place in my own town that I can rate 5 stars…read more Cooper's is a small pub located in Pearl River. There's street parking around the neighborhood that becomes free after 6. I suggest you head towards the houses, away from town, if you can't find a spot. I've been anxious to try this place as the pictures look solid enough and reviewers thus far seem content. My wife and I entered with plans to have beer and apps. We ended up getting Guinness, onion rings, fried calamari and the Cooper's Burger. You can't beat a 22oz Guinness for $8. The prices on their website also match what you'll see inside. Lately I find so many restaurants are charging more than they advertise online. Service was great, friendly and very attentive. I was also surprised to see how well they clean tables between customers. Spray, wipe table, wipe lamp, shakers, etc. It's totally clean for the next customer. There are only 8 or so tables in here, plus bar seating. We enjoyed some comfy seats at a high top table for two. The onion rings were great - crisp and battered nicely so they hold together. While almost a little overcooked, they were still good and better than I had at the last high end steakhouse I went to. The fried calamari was fairly priced and a good portion. It had a light crispness, though bigger pieces would've been nicer. They were mostly small, but certainly a lot of it. The accompanying marinara was good and plentiful. We got the Cooper's Burger cooked medium and it came out medium. It's a simple burger that comes with lettuce and tomato. Some red onion wouldn't been nice. They charge extra for all sorts of stuff you can get on top - fried mushrooms, fried onions, eggs, etc. It also comes with fries, which were good. Overall, it was a nice cozy time. Several middle aged couples ate here that night and a couple small groups. No loud bar crowds as they're all on central avenue. In fact, I was surprised how nice the acoustics were inside. You can hear people at your table no problem, can hear the music inside at the right level and don't hear a lot of background chatter or noise. I'd most certainly return if in the mood for pub food. And ... No credit card fee!
